Rescue teams in Athens are searching through rubble after a four-storey apartment building collapses in the city’s Petralona area. Greek fire brigade officials report that the emergency response is ongoing at the site, with crews working to locate anyone still trapped. Local media footage shows workers moving through debris as they look for signs of life. Four people reported trapped are found and confirmed safe, according to the fire brigade. Rescue dogs are used as part of the search, while other emergency forces assist with the operation. Authorities do not indicate in the available reports how many people were inside at the time of the collapse, beyond the earlier reports of four trapped residents. The search continues as responders check for additional survivors and assess the scene. The collapse triggers an active rescue effort involving firefighting and search-and-rescue personnel.
